/**公共部分**/
*{margin:0px; padding:0px;}
img{border:none; vertical-align:top;}
li{list-style-type:none;}
ul,dl,ol{list-style:none;}

body{font:14px "微软雅黑";background:#f5f5f5;}
address,cite,code,em,th{font-weight:normal; font-style:normal;}
.clear{clear:both;}
a{outline: none;}
ol,ul {list-style:none;}
li{list-style-type:none;}
img{vertical-align:top;border:0;}
a{color:#555;text-decoration:none}
a:hover{text-decoration:none;color:#fd8522}
img{border:0;vertical-align:middle;}
img:hover{opacity:0.9; -moz-opacity:0.9; filter:alpha(opacity=90);}

.menu_bg{ width:100%;height:55px; padding-top:1px; padding-bottom:1px;margin-bottom:10px;height: 42px; line-height: 42px; border-bottom: 1px solid #edf0f1; background: #f6f7f8; line-height: 42px; overflow: hidden;}
.menu {width: 1400px;margin: 0 auto;font-family: "Microsoft YaHei";color: #FFF;overflow: hidden;}
.img-css {float:left;width:106px;height:47px;}
.rfnr,.rf{ float:right}
.rfb{ margin-right: 30px;}
.rfnr,.rf img{ line-height: 42px; display: inline-block; vertical-align: middle; margin-right: 8px; } 
.qz-register {position: absolute;content: "";display: inline-block;margin-left:740px;top: 0px;font-size: 15px;}
.qz-register .qz-reg-suc {color: #fd8522;width:550px;}
.qz-register .qz-reg-suc .tc1,.qz-register .qz-reg-suc .tc2,.qz-register .qz-reg-suc .tc3 {float:left;}
.qz-register .qz-reg-suc .tc4 {background:#cf2a2a;float:right;width:80px;height:30px;margin-top:7px;line-height:30px;text-align:center;color:#ffffff;border-radius:25px;}
.tc1 span {color:#3888ff;}
.content{ width:1400px; margin:0 auto;overflow:hidden;background:#ffffff;}
.main-centont{float:left;width:1400px;height:auto;margin-top:20px;margin-left:10px;}
.cbanner{float:left;width:588px;height:310px;overflow:hidden;position:relative;}
.cbanner ul{width:2950px;height:310px;position:absolute;left:0;top:0;}
.cbanner ul li{width:588px;height:310px;float:left;}
.cbanner ul li img{width:588px;height:310px;float:left;}
.cbfBtn{position:absolute;bottom:-11px;width:120px;height:66px;line-height:66px;margin:0px 0 0 480px;text-align:center;}
.cbfBtn span{width:13px;height:13px;display:inline-block;border-radius:50%;background:#3d3d3d;margin-left:6px;}
#num .active{background:#ffffff;}
.main-centont-r {float:left;width:780px;height:310px;margin-left:10px;}
.hang {float:left;width:1380px;height:50px;}
.hang .han01,.han03,.han04,.han05 {float:left;}
.hang .han02 {float:right;}
.hang .han02 a {background:#cf2a2a;float:right;width:80px;height:30px;margin-top:7px;line-height:30px;text-align:center;color:#ffffff;border-radius:25px;}
.hang .han03 {float:left;margin-left:40px;margin-top:10px;font-size:20px;}
.hang .han03 a {margin-right:20px;}
.hang .han03 a.ok {color:#3888ff;text-decoration: underline;}
.ul-toppictxt4 img{width: 100%;height: 100%;display: block;}
.ul-toppictxt4{overflow: hidden;}
.ul-toppictxt4 li{float: left;margin: 0 5px 10px;}
.ul-toppictxt4 .pic{width: 250px;height:110px;border-radius:10px;overflow: hidden;}
.ul-toppictxt4 .txt{overflow: hidden;padding: 0 10px;}
.ul-toppictxt4 .tit{float: left;width: 210px;height:30px;}
.ul-toppictxt4 h3{height:30px;font-size: 14px;font-weight: 700;line-height: 40px;color: #202020;text-align:left;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.lie01 {float:left;width:459px;}
.tab-cont-wrap li {float:left;width:459px;}
.left2_wen{display: block;width:459px;overflow: hidden;zoom: 1;padding: 16px 0;border-bottom: 1px dashed #eeeeee;}
.left2_wl{ width:200px; height:120px; float:left;}
.left2_wl img{ width:200px; height:120px;border-radius:10px;}
.left2_wr{ float:left; line-height:35px; font-size:14px; padding-top:5px;margin-left:10px;width:240px; overflow:hidden; font-size:16px; font-weight:bold; overflow:hidden;white-space:nowrap;text-overflow:ellipsis;}
.left2_ms{ height:55px; float:left;margin-left:10px;width:240px;color: #999;line-height: 25px; display:block;overflow:hidden}
.left2_cd{ height:30px; width:249px; float:left;margin-left:10px;color:#a7a7a7;}
.left2_csj{ height:30px; float:left;line-height: 25px;}
.news,.czhi{float:left;width:1370px;height:auto;margin-top:20px;margin-left:20px;}
.news .news-01 {float:left;width:370px;height:400px;}
.news .news-01 .news-tx {width:370px;float:left;text-align:center;margin-top:25px;}
.news .news-01 .news-tx img {border-radius:50%;}
.news .news-01 .news-zz {width:370px;float:left;text-align:center;font-size:18px;font-weight:bold;margin-top:15px;}
.news .news-01 .news-gzd {width:370px;float:left;text-align:center;font-size:16px;margin-top:5px;}
.news .news-01 .news-gz {width:370px;float:left;text-align:center;margin-top:15px;}
.news .news-01 .news-gz a {background:#da3333;color:#ffffff;font-size:18px;text-align:center;display: inline-block;width:150px;height:40px;line-height:40px;border-radius:25px;}
.news .news-01 .news-an {width:370px;float:left;text-align:center;margin-top:15px;}
.news .news-01 .news-an a {margin:0 10px;}
.news .news-02 {float:left;width:970px;margin-left:20px;}
.news .news-02 .news-tit {float:left;width:100%;height:70px;line-height:70px;text-align:center;font-size:26px;}
.news .news-02 .news-zw {float:left;width:100%;line-height:25px;text-align:left;font-size:16px;margin-bottom:70px;}
.news .news-03 {float:left;width:170px;height:400px;}
.news .news-03 .news-ljie01,.news .news-03 .news-ljie02,.news .news-03 .news-ljie03 {float:left;width:170px;height:50px;}
.news .news-03 .news-ljie01 a {float:left;width:114px;height:22px;background:url(ico9.jpg) no-repeat;}
.news .news-03 .news-ljie01 a:hover,.news .news-03 .news-ljie01 a.ok {float:left;width:114px;height:22px;background:url(ico9.jpg) 0 -22px no-repeat;}
.news .news-03 .news-ljie02 a {float:left;width:114px;height:22px;background:url(ico10.jpg) no-repeat;}
.news .news-03 .news-ljie02 a:hover,.news .news-03 .news-ljie02 a.ok {float:left;width:114px;height:22px;background:url(ico10.jpg) 0 -22px no-repeat;}
.news .news-03 .news-ljie03 a {float:left;width:114px;height:22px;background:url(ico11.jpg) no-repeat;}
.news .news-03 .news-ljie03 a:hover,.news .news-03 .news-ljie03 a.ok {float:left;width:114px;height:22px;background:url(ico11.jpg) 0 -22px no-repeat;}
.news .news-02 .ht-01 {float:left;width:970px;height:50px;text-align:left;text-align:left;font-weight:700;line-height:50px;font-size:18px;}
.news .news-02 .ht-02 {float:left;width:970px;height:380px;text-align:left;text-align:left;font-weight:700;line-height:30px;font-size:18px;}
.news .news-02 .ht-01 span,.news .news-02 .ht-02 span {float:left;text-align:left;}
.news .news-02 .ht-01 .txt {background:#c8c8c8;border:0;width:740px;height:35px;line-height:35px;font-size:18px;}
.news .news-02 .ht-02 textarea {background:#c8c8c8;border:0;width:720px;height:335px;line-height:35px;font-size:18px;padding:10px;}
.news .news-02 .ht-03 {float:left;width:920px;height:150px;text-align:center;}
.news .news-02 .ht-03 a{background:#cf2a2a;display: inline-block;width:280px;height:70px;line-height:70px;font-weight:700;font-size:22px;text-align:center;color:#ffffff;border-radius:45px;margin:0 20px;}
.news .news-02 .ht-04 {float:left;width:970px;height:380px;text-align:left;text-align:left;font-weight:700;line-height:30px;font-size:18px;color:#cf2a2a;}
.news .news-02 .ht-05 {float:left;width:900px;height:350px;border: 1px dashed #454545;text-align:center;border-radius:45px;margin-bottom:25px;}
.news .news-02 .ht-05 a{background:#cf2a2a;display: inline-block;width:280px;height:70px;line-height:70px;font-weight:700;font-size:22px;text-align:center;color:#ffffff;border-radius:45px;margin-top:100px;margin-bottom:10px;}
.news .news-02 .ht-06 {float:left;width:970px;height:380px;text-align:left;text-align:left;font-weight:700;line-height:30px;font-size:18px;}
.news .news-02 .ht-06 .shour01,.news .news-02 .ht-06 .shour02,.news .news-02 .ht-06 .shour03 {float:left;width:100%;}
.news .news-02 .ht-06 .shour01 span {color:#3888ff;}
.news .news-02 .ht-06 .shour02 a{background:#cf2a2a;float:left;width:120px;height:30px;line-height:30px;font-weight:700;font-size:16px;text-align:center;color:#ffffff;border-radius:45px;margin-top:10px;margin-bottom:10px;}


.news .news-02 .ht-07 {float:left;width:970px;height:300px;text-align:left;text-align:left;font-weight:700;line-height:30px;font-size:18px;}
.news .news-02 .ht-07 .shuju01 {float:left;width:206px;height:250px;background:url(ico12.jpg) no-repeat;margin-right:30px;}
.news .news-02 .ht-07 .shuju02 {float:left;width:206px;height:250px;background:url(ico13.jpg) no-repeat;margin-right:30px;}
.news .news-02 .ht-07 .shuju03 {float:left;width:206px;height:250px;background:url(ico14.jpg) no-repeat;margin-right:30px;}
.news .news-02 .ht-07 .shuju04 {float:left;width:206px;height:250px;background:url(ico15.jpg) no-repeat;}
.news .news-02 .ht-07 .shuju01 span {float:left;width:206px;height:25px;line-height:25px;text-align:center;}
.news .news-02 .ht-07 .shuju02 span {float:left;width:206px;height:25px;line-height:25px;text-align:center;}
.news .news-02 .ht-07 .shuju03 span {float:left;width:206px;height:25px;line-height:25px;text-align:center;}
.news .news-02 .ht-07 .shuju04 span {float:left;width:206px;height:25px;line-height:25px;text-align:center;}

.news .news-02 .ht-08 {float:left;width:970px;height:80px;text-align:left;text-align:left;font-weight:700;line-height:30px;font-size:18px;}

.czhi .czhi01 {float:left;width:150px;height:700px;}
.czhi .czhi02 {float:left;width:1170px;margin-left:40px;}
.czhi .czhi02 .jine {float:left;width:1170px;height:150px;text-align:left;}
.czhi .czhi02 .jine a {display: inline-block;text-align:center;width:200px;height:50px;font-weight:700;line-height:50px;font-size:18px;border:2px solid #454545;border-radius:25px;margin:10px 5px;}
.czhi .czhi02 .jine a.ok {border:2px solid #cf2a2a;background:#cf2a2a;color:#ffffff;}
.czhi .czhi02 .jine01 {float:left;width:1170px;height:50px;text-align:left;font-weight:700;line-height:50px;font-size:18px;}
.czhi .czhi02 .jine02 {float:left;width:1170px;height:100px;text-align:left;}
.czhi .czhi02 .jine02 .texs {float:left;width:1170px;text-align:left;margin-top:10px;}
.czhi .czhi02 .jine02 .texs .input {text-align:left;width:600px;height:45px;line-height:45px;font-size:16px;}
.czhi .czhi02 .jine02 .texs .input .txt {margin-left:15px;background:#c8c8c8;border:0;width:340px;height:35px;line-height:35px;font-size:18px;}
.czhi .czhi02 .jine02 .texs .input .txt1 {margin-left:25px;background:#c8c8c8;border:0;width:340px;height:35px;line-height:35px;font-size:18px;}
.czhi .czhi02 .jine03 {float:left;width:1170px;height:50px;text-align:left;font-weight:700;line-height:50px;font-size:18px;}
.czhi .czhi02 .jine04 {float:left;width:1170px;height:150px;text-align:center;}
.czhi .czhi02 .jine04 {float:left;width:1170px;height:280px;text-align:center;}
.czhi .czhi02 .jine04 a {margin:0 20px;}
.czhi .czhi02 .jine05 {float:left;width:1170px;height:150px;text-align:center;}
.czhi .czhi02 .jine05 a{background:#cf2a2a;display: inline-block;width:280px;height:70px;margin-top:7px;line-height:70px;font-weight:700;font-size:22px;text-align:center;color:#ffffff;border-radius:45px;}



.bottom{width:100%;background: #4796d8;color: #76b2e3;overflow:auto;}
.bottom_c{width:1002px;text-align:center;padding:10px 0px;font-family:Arial, Helvetica, sans-serif;border-top: 1px dotted #76b2e3;margin:0 auto;}

.sp {position: fixed;width:0;height:0;overflow: hidden;left: 0;top: 0;bottom: 0;right: 0;margin: auto;background: rgba(0, 0, 0, .8);z-index: 555555555;}
.spinner {width:500px;height:350px;background:#ffffff;;position: absolute;left: 0;top: 0;bottom: 0;right: 0;margin: auto;border-radius:25px;}
.spinner i {position: absolute;width:21px;height:21px;right:15px;top:15px;cursor: pointer;transition: all .3s ease-in;background:url(gb.png) no-repeat;}
.sp .spinner .texs {margin:0 auto;width:440px;text-align:center;margin-top:10px;padding:30px;}
.sp .spinner .texs h1 {text-align:center;line-height:30px;height:45px;font-size:26px;color:#000000;}
.sp .spinner .texs h2 {text-align:center;line-height:25px;height:35px;font-size:18px;color:#000000;font-weight:normal; }
.sp .spinner .texs .wenben {text-align:left;font-size:17px;}
.sp .spinner .texs .wenben img {width:90%;margin-left:30px;}
.sp .spinner .texs .anniu {text-align:center;line-height:30px;font-size:16px;color:#fff;margin-top:30px;}
.sp .spinner .texs .anniu a {background:#da3333;color:#ffffff;font-size:20px;text-align:center;display: inline-block;width:150px;height:50px;line-height:50px;border-radius:25px;}

.bg {background:url(tan01.png) no-repeat;width:850px;height:450px;}
.sp .bg .texs {margin:0 auto;width:370px;text-align:center;margin-left:402px;margin-top:10px;}
.sp .bg .texs h1 {text-align:center;line-height:30px;height:45px;font-size:26px;color:#000000;}
.sp .bg .texs .wenben {text-align:center;font-size:15px;}
.sp .bg .texs .wenben img {width:185px;height:185px;margin-top:15px;margin-bottom:15px;}
.sp .bg .texs .input {text-align:left;height:45px;line-height:45px;font-size:16px;}
.sp .bg .texs .input .txt {background:#c8c8c8;border:0;width:240px;height:35px;line-height:35px;font-size:18px;}
.sp .bg .texs .stt {text-align:center;font-size:16px;margin-top:30px;margin-bottom:-15px;}